The 42nd annual Academy of Country Music (ACM) Awards returned to Las Vegas this past May 15th. Hosted by superstar Reba McEntire, several of country music’s biggest stars performed as part of the celebration—but the ACM Awards show wasn’t the only game in town. The festivities included both pre- and after- awards show parties, and for these gala events, Las Vegas-based H.A.S. Productions provided sound reinforcement using a collection of loudspeakers from the D.A.S. Audio Aero catalog. This year’s pre-and post-awards show parties took place in the Grand Ballroom of the MGM Grand Hotel. H.A.S. Productions, a well-known provider of live event services, including concert audio production, lighting, staging, and backline, was contracted to handle sound for the parties. Using twenty D.A.S. Audio Aero 48 line array elements—flown ten per side—in conjunction with six CA-215A subwoofers for onstage side and drum fills, the audience was treated to some of the finest country music Las Vegas has experienced in years. The D.A.S. Audio Aero 48 is an externally powered, high efficiency line array module that integrates low, mid, and high frequency transducers into a single enclosure. With its trapezoidal shape and rear located splay angle adjusters that keep the front spacing between adjacent elements consistent, the Aero 48’s provide the ability to create a seamless front baffle for improved array performance. The CA-215A is a monoamplified subwoofer featuring two front-loaded D.A.S. Audio 15GN transducers in a bass-reflex configuration. When queried about his selection of the D.A.S.
